Brentford star Ivan Toney ‘can’t wait to score goals in the Premier League’ after Bees secure promotion

Brentford striker Ivan Toney capped his stunning season with a Play-off Final goal and then warned top-flight defences: “I’m a Premier League striker now - I can’t wait to score there!” â€¨

Toney broke the record for the most Championship goals in a season by scoring 31 times following his move from Peterborough United last summer.ʉ۬

The forward added a crucial 32nd in last weekend’s semi-final win over Bournemouth and made it 33 to send Brentford on their way to a 2-0 Wembley victory over Swansea and into the top-flight for the first time since 1947.


While the likes of Neal Maupay and Ollie Watkins have earned Premier League moves off the back of prolific campaigns in the second tier with Brentford, Toney has now gone a step further, firing the Bees to promotion.


"It's crazy. I've got no words, my voice is going,” he told Sky Sports.


"It's the best dressing room I've been in, I've loved every minute of it.


"I'm in the Premier League with the best bunch of boys I could ever dream of.


"I'm a Premier League striker now and I can't wait to score goals there."
